02-03-10weratherchannelIf you were watching the Weather Channel the other day, you may have noticed an odd black and white pattern that read “Android Users Scan Here”.

The would be a QR code, and this would be an augmented reality app that could be scanned by an Android powered phone If you happened to have one, and followed its instruction, then your phone would go to the Android market for you to buy the Weather Channel’s app.

All in all, not a bad way to advertise. I can’t help but wonder if we’ll see more things advertised in such a manner.
